毕业设计说明书(论文)作 者 :学 号:学 院 :电子与电气工程学院专 业 :自动化题 目 :基于单片机的 LED 智能照明驱动及控制系统-硬件部分毕业设计说明书(论文)中文摘要 摘要 摘要:LED(即发光二极管)为半导体二极管的一种,是一种能够将电能转变成光能的工具。LED 作为现代化新型照明灯具和设施,它集体积小、耗能低、使用寿命长和绿色环保等诸多优点于一身。LED 阵列,控制电路和驱动电路这三部分构成 LED 灯具,其中 LED 灯具的品质和寿命与 LED 的驱动电路性能有直接关系。所以在本次设计中 LED 的驱动电路设计将十分重要。如今 LED 驱动电路的功率因数低和效率低是主要的不足之处,它们分别会造成谐波污染和降低电能利用。为了解决这些问题,本次设计将实行高效率和高功率因数的 LED 驱动电路。为了能够更好地利用电能,本次设计将利用单片机实现智能照明,使 LED 实现自动控制,合理的灯光调节将更加节约用电。最终本次设计实现了 LED 智能照明驱动及控制系统的硬件达成,而且系统运行良好,结果表明各项功能及参数均满足本次设计要求。关键词 LED,单片机,开关电源,智能照明毕业设计说明书(论文)外文摘要Title Microcontroller-based intelligent LED lighting and drive systems Abstract : LED ( light-emitting diode ) is a semiconductor diode , is capable of converting an electric energy into light tool.
